Turkmen Akhal-Teke Horses to Participate in Races and the “Pearl of the East” Beauty Competition in Tashkent

Turkmenistan will present its Akhal-Teke horses at equestrian competitions and the “Pearl of the East” beauty contest, which will take place on May 9–10 in Tashkent, Republic of Uzbekistan. Preparations for participation in this international event, which is intended to further enhance the fame of our “heavenly” horses, were reported at Friday’s Cabinet of Ministers meeting by Deputy Prime Minister T. Atahallyyev, who oversees the country’s equestrian sector.

He also noted that, as part of the upcoming visit of the Turkmen delegation to Uzbekistan, participation is planned in the conference “The Akhal-Teke Horse – a Symbol of Friendship Among Nations.”

According to the organizers, the first day of the program will feature horse races over distances ranging from 1,000 to 2,400 meters. On the second day, the “Pearl of the East” beauty and conformation competition will be held as a parade and exhibition, showcasing to the world the exemplary grace and elegance of the Akhal-Teke breed.

After hearing the report, President of Turkmenistan Serdar Berdimuhamedov instructed the Deputy Prime Minister to take all necessary measures to ensure the successful participation of Turkmen horse breeders and Akhal-Teke horses in the upcoming equestrian competitions and beauty contest.

It is worth recalling that 2026 in our country is being observed under the motto: “Independent Neutral Turkmenistan – the Homeland of Purposeful Winged Horses.”
